Usually, the problem isn’t your ink—it’s that the ink didn’t actually “set” all the way through. That’s where Gallium Iodide (GaI) lamps come in. Most standard mercury lamps just don’t cut it when you’re working with thick, pigmented inks. The UV light hits the surface, but it can’t punch through to the bottom. You end up with a “skin” of cured ink on top and a gooey mess underneath. GaI lamps are different. They push out longer wavelengths (between 300nm and 420nm) that actually soak into the fibers. Instead of just sitting on top of the fabric, the ink bonds deep inside.The result? A print that actually stays put.

Setting Them Up and Keeping Them Happy
The best part is that these aren’t a headache to install. They’re designed to slide right into your existing UV tunnels. We match your current pin layouts, so you can just plug them in and get back to work. One tip to keep them running strong: clean those quartz sleeves every 500 hours. It sounds like a chore, but dust is the enemy here. When grime builds up on the glass, it blocks the UV light and creates “hot spots.” Those hot spots can crack your tubes. Keep the glass sparkling, and your lamps will actually last as long as they’re supposed to.
